Upgrading and Installing Mass Storage Devices
Which IDE Data
Connectors to Use
There are three data cables inside your PC (or four if your PC is fitted
with a SCSI adapter). Two of these are for IDE devices.
•
An Enhanced Ultra ATA IDE (Integrated Drive Electronics) hard
disk drive cable.
For optimum performance, use this cable to connect the Ultra ATA
IDE hard disk drive.
•
A second IDE drive cable that supports two IDE devices. If you
install a CD-ROM drive, a DVD drive or a Zip drive, connect it to this
cable.
•
The third cable is non-IDE and has one connector for a floppy drive.
Up to four IDE devices can be connected to the system board using the
IDE data cables.
